【格言分享】程序员的经典名言解读

news/2024/11/1 2:36:01/

上一期文章我们分享了一些程序员的经典名言,每一句都蕴含着深刻的道理。

接下来就给大家一个一个分析一下

这些格言确实捕捉到了编程和软件开发的精髓,每一条都蕴含着丰富的经验和智慧。下面我将逐一解释这些格言,并分享一些我的看法。

  1. C程序员永远不会灭亡。他们只是cast成了void。

    • 这句话以幽默的方式表达了C语言程序员的坚韧和持久性。在编程世界中,C语言是一种非常底层、强大的语言,程序员们常常需要处理各种复杂的内存管理和指针操作。因此,即使他们“消失”了,他们的技能和知识也仍然以某种形式存在于代码中,就像被“cast成了void”一样。
  2. 最初的90%的代码用去了最初90%的开发时间。余下的10%的代码用掉另外90%的开发时间。

    • 这句话揭示了软件开发中的一个普遍现象:在项目的早期阶段,进展通常很快,因为大部分功能都可以相对容易地实现。然而,随着项目的深入,剩下的少数功能往往涉及更复杂的逻辑和更多的依赖关系,因此会消耗更多的时间和精力。
  3. 如果debugging是一种消灭bug的过程,那编程就一定是把bug放进去的过程。


http://www.ppmy.cn/news/1543467.html

相关文章

day03-LogStash

LogStash环境搭建 1.下载Logstash [10:17:18 rootelk2:/usr/local]#wget http://192.168.13.253/Resources/ElasticStack/softwares/logstash-7.17.23-amd64.deb2.安装Logstash [10:17:35 rootelk2:/usr/local]#dpkg -i logstash-7.17.23-amd64.deb 3.创建软连接&#xff0…

python psutil 模块概述

文章目录 psutil 模块概述支持的系统安装 psutil 使用示例CPU 信息获取内存信息获取磁盘信息获取网络信息获取 进程管理功能查看系统进程获取进程详情示例脚本:监控系统资源 总结核心功能使用场景主要优点 psutil 模块概述 psutil 是一个强大的跨平台 Python 库&am…

无人机之集群控制方法篇

无人机的集群控制方法涉及多个技术和策略,以确保多架无人机能够协同、高效地执行任务。以下是一些主要的无人机集群控制方法: 一、编队控制方法 领航-跟随法(Leader-Follower) 通过设定一架无人机作为领航者(长机&am…

java.sql.SQLException: ORA-00971: 缺失 SET 关键字

目录 背景: 过程: 错误原因: 解决办法: 总结: 背景: 正在运行某个项目程序,提交信息之后发现库中并没有刚刚的相关数据,后来查看后台信息,发现提示错误,java.sql.SQLException…

ReactNative 启动应用(2)

ReactNative 启动应用 简述 本节我们来看一下ReactNative在Android上启动Activity的流程,ReactNative在Android上也是一个Apk,它的实现全部都在应用层,所以它肯定也是符合我们Android应用的启动流程的,UI页面的载体也是一个Acti…

appium文本输入的多种形式

目录 一、send_keys方法 二、press_keycode方法 三、subprocess方法直接通过adb命令输入 一、send_keys方法 这个是最常用的方法,不过通常使用时要使用聚焦,也就是先点击后等待: element wait.until(EC.presence_of_element_located((By…

Redis 淘汰策略 问题

前言 相关系列 《Redis & 目录》《Redis & 淘汰策略 & 源码》《Redis & 淘汰策略 & 总结》《Redis & 淘汰策略 & 问题》 参考文献 《Redis过期策略和淘汰策略》 在内存耗尽的情况访问Redis会发生什么? 如果是读指令会正常返回…

初识字节码文件--Java

1,问题:请问以下代码,每行创建了几个对象? public static void main(String[] args) {String a "你好";String b new String("你好");String c "你" "好";} 如何查看字节码 方法一…